小编tho*_*oth的帖子

jekyll调试或打印所有变量

我想要进入Jekyll的大脑,看看发生了什么,在php中你有get_defined_vars,所以我尝试做类似的事情:

      {% for local_variable in local_variables %}
      <p> {{ local_variable }} </p><br>
      {% endfor %}
Run Code Online (Sandbox Code Playgroud)

哪个输出没什么.我努力了吗?在ruby或jekyll中有一些方法吗?我只是想四处寻找并确保一切设置正确,并可能找出我不知道的变量.

ruby debugging jekyll

27
推荐指数
4
解决办法
9675
查看次数

循环进入舵图模板

我试图像这样在kubernetes掌舵图中循环计数:

reaction.mongo_url_big: mongodb://{{ for $mongocount := 0; $mongocount < {{ .Values.mongodbReplicantCount }}; $mongocount++ }}{{ .Values.mongodbReleaseName }}-mongodb-replicaset-{{ $mongocount }}:{{ .Values.mongodbPort }}{{ if $mongocount < {{ .Values.mongodbReplicantCount }} - 1 }},{{ end }}{{ end }}/{{ .Values.mongodbName }}?replicaSet={{ .Values.mongodbReplicaSet }}
Run Code Online (Sandbox Code Playgroud)

但是,go模板中没有可用的模板,因为它们会告诉您自己

我希望它输出如下内容:

 reaction.mongo_url: mongodb://{{ .Values.mongodbReleaseName }}-mongodb-replicaset-0:{{ .Values.mongodbPort }},{{ .Values.mongodbReleaseName }}-mongodb-replicaset-1:{{ .Values.mongodbPort }},{{ .Values.mongodbReleaseName }}-mongodb-replicaset-2:{{ .Values.mongodbPort }}/{{ .Values.mongodbName }}?replicaSet={{ .Values.mongodbReplicaSet }}
Run Code Online (Sandbox Code Playgroud)

我的掌舵图中的线在这里:https : //github.com/joshuacox/reactionetes/blob/gymongonasium/reactioncommerce/templates/configmap.yaml#L11

kubernetes kubernetes-helm

1
推荐指数
2
解决办法
9214
查看次数

标签 统计

debugging ×1

jekyll ×1

kubernetes ×1

kubernetes-helm ×1

ruby ×1